The LM78XX series of voltage regulators are commonly used in various electronics appliances and projects. LM7812 IC comes in the family and provides a fixed regulated output of 12V DC for a variable input voltage range of 14.5 to 27V DC.

The 7805 Voltage Regulator IC is a commonly used voltage regulator that finds its application in most of the electronics projects. It provides a constant +5V output voltage for a variable input voltage supply.

XC6206 is a highly precise voltage regulator with low power consumption (1.0 µA) and low dropout voltage of 250 mV at 100 mA. Maximum operating voltage for XC6206 is 6.0 V and output voltage range is 1.2 V to 5 V.
